想懂你的眸你却带了瞳
[xiăng dŏng nĭ de móu nĭ què dài le tóng]
It means “I want to understand you through your eyes, but you're wearing colored contacts (or just something making it hard).” It uses a metaphor for attempting to understand the inner world of a person through their gaze yet encountering difficulty as if this person hides behind lenses. It represents an endeavor to know someone truly, despite barriers. '瞳(tóng)' specifically means the eye pupil which can also be translated as colored contact lenses.
